Making Wintermester Affordable

Thinking about Wintermester? Here are a few key things you’ll need to know before you start.

  • Complete the Wintermester Financial Aid Application Request located in Etrieve. The deadline to submit is December 1.
  • Students may enroll in up to four (4) credit hours. Please be aware that the Pell Grant is the only financial aid available for Wintermester. If you qualify, using these funds will reduce your Spring award. For example, if your Spring eligibility is $2,000 and you use $500 for Wintermester, your remaining Spring balance will be $1,500.
  • Institutional scholarships cannot be applied toward Wintermester expenses.
  • Prior to registration, speak with your financial aid advisor regarding your eligibility and any potential impact on your Spring Pell Grant.
  • Pell Grant disbursements occur after Wintermester classes begin. If you wish to apply your Pell Grant toward these costs with the understanding that it will reduce your Spring eligibility, you must complete the Wintermester Financial Aid Application Request before the fee payment deadline.
